I'm deliverning local messages to users using
maildrop -d user@domain -w 90
where user@domain is found in LDAP and all maildirs have a quota
(maildirsize).
There are no local users, entries in LDAP don't have uid, uidnumber or
gidnumber attribute and every maildir was created using the same uid/gid
which is configured in default_uidnumber/default_gidnumber.
The problem is that, for some reason I don't understand, users are
receiving the quotawarnmsg for every delivery try when they exceed 90% of
their quota and even when the 100% quota is reached.
Anyone has any hints about this?
